In Mask-picture-projection-based mostly stereolithography, a 3D electronic model is sliced by a list of horizontal planes. Each and every slice is transformed into a two-dimensional mask picture. The mask impression is then projected on to a photocurable liquid resin surface and lightweight is projected onto the resin to cure it in the shape of your layer.[55] Constant liquid interface production starts which has a pool of liquid photopolymer resin. Section of the pool base is clear to ultraviolet light (the "window"), which will cause the resin to solidify.

The 2 most commonly identified strategies available for commercial use now are “Powder Bed Fusion” (PBF) and Powder Fed “Directed Energy Deposition” (DED) units. PBF programs use a laser to selectively melt a bed of metallic powder layer by layer to build up the Actual physical section. Soon after the very first layer is distribute and sintered, the bed is stuffed once more using a 2nd layer of powder and selectively sintered. This method is recurring right until the aspect is fully formed. The end result is buried while in the powder cake and isn't seen until eventually the excess powder is eliminated (see figure 1).

3D printable styles could possibly be produced with a computer-aided layout (CAD) package, via a 3D scanner, or by a plain digital camera and photogrammetry program. 3D printed versions established with CAD bring about lessened mistakes and might be corrected just before printing, allowing for verification in the design of the item ahead of it truly is printed.
